Product Description
The 8X USMC-SNIPER scope is a piece of history. One of the most recognized names in military sniping during the Vietnam conflict was Marine Corps marksman Carlos Hathcock. The rifle he relied on for very precise long range shot placement was a Match Grade Model 70 Winchester, of.30-06 caliber, topped with an 8x USMC SNIPER scope. Finding one of these scopes in excellent working condition today is next to impossible, since Marine Corps snipers used these optics during WWII.in Korea.and during the early years of Vietnam. Such precision never goes out of style, and Hi-Lux Optics is proud to add an entirely new made model of these older style external adjustment scopes to our Wm. Malcolm line – the 8x USMC SNIPER model. This is an extremely high quality scope, offering all of the precision and features of the best scopes of this style from the past. The one thing we did different has been to use far better glass lenses than you will ever find in an original – no matter who built it. The Wm. Malcolm 8X USMC SNIPER model has become a favorite of shooters competing in Vintage Sniper Rifle matches. Like the original it duplicates, this scope comes with a meticulously machined micrometer click adjustment rear mount, a sliding front mount with recoil return spring, and front lens parallax adjustment. The scopes are marked with the Wm. Malcolm name over the USMC-SNIPER model designation, and each is serial numbered ” as were the original USMC models.

Rifle Scope Product Features
8x USMC external micrometer click adjustment scope 31mm objective lens recoil spring in box as an accessory
Fully multi-coated lens
Comes with two blocks for mounting on 1903A1 or 1941A1
Fully multi-coated lenses
Fine-cross hair reticle

Scope Facts
Rifle scopes permit you to exactly align a rifle at different targets by lining up your eye with the target over a distance. They accomplish this through zoom by utilizing a set of lenses inside the scope. The scope’s alignment can be adjusted for the consideration of many natural things like wind speed and elevation to make up for bullet drop.
The scope’s function is to help the shooter understand precisely where the bullet will hit based on the sight picture you are viewing with the optic as you line up the scope’s crosshair or reticle with the target. Fixed Power Lens Rifle Optic Details
A single power rifle scope and optic uses a magnification number designator like 4×32. This implies the magnification power of the scope is 4x power while the objective lens is 32mm. The magnification of this kind of scope can not adjust since it is a set power scope.
About Adjustable Power Lens Rifle Scopes
Variable power rifle scopes use enhanced power. The power change is handled using the power ring part of the scope near the rear of the scope by the eye bell.

Hydrophobic Lens Coatings
Water on a scope lens doesn’t assist with preserving a clear sight picture through a scope in any way. Many top of the line and high-end optic producers will coat their lenses with a hydrophobic or hydrophilic coating. The Steiner Optics Nano-Protection is a good example of this kind of treatment. It treats the exterior surfaces of the Steiner optic lens so the H2O molecules can not bind to it or create surface tension. The outcome is that the water beads slide off of the scope to keep a clear, water free sight picture.

Hex Key Rifle Optic Ring Mounts
Standard, clamp-on style mounting scope rings use hex head screws to fix to the flattop design Picatinny scope mounting rails on the tops of rifles. These forms of scope mounts use double individual rings to support the optic, and are normally constructed from 7075 T6 billet aluminum or similar materials which are designed for far away precision shooting. This kind of scope mount is great for rifle systems which are in need of a resilient, unfailing mount which will not change no matter how much the scope is moved about or abuse the rifle takes. These are the type of mounts you should get for a specialized scope setup on a long distance hunting or competition long gun which will almost never need to be changed or adjusted. Blue 242 Loctite threadlocker can also be used on the scope mount screws to stop the hex screw threads from backing out after they are mounted safely in place. An example of these rings are the 30mm type from Vortex Optics. The set typically costs around $200 USD
Quick-Release Cantilever Scope Ring Mounting Solutions
These kinds of quick-release rifle scope mounts can be used to quickly detach a scope from a rifle and reattach it to a different rifle. If they all use a similar style mount, several scopes can also be swapped out. The quick detach design is CNC crafted from anodized 6061 T6 aluminum and the mounting levers attach tightly to a flat top style Picatinny rail. This lets the scope to be sighted in while on the rifle, taken off of the rifle, and remounted back on the rifle while retaining accuracy. These types of mounts come in convenient for rifles which are moved around a lot, to take off the optic from the rifle for protection, or for sight systems which are adopted between several rifles. An example of this mount type is the 30mm mount designed by the Vortex Optics brand. It normally costs around $250 USD
Sealing and Gas Purging for Glass Tubes
Wetness inside your rifle glass can mess up a day of shooting and your pricey optic by inducing fogging and creating residue inside of the scope’s tube. The majority of scopes prevent wetness from going into the optical tube with a system of sealing O-rings which are waterproof. Generally, these optics can be submerged within 20 or 30 feet of water before the water pressure can force moisture past the O-rings. This should be sufficient moisture content prevention for common use rifles for hunting and sporting purposes, unless you plan on taking your rifle on your motorboat and are concerned about the scope still functioning if it goes overboard and you can still recover the rifle.
Rifle Optic Gas Purging
Another part of avoiding the buildup of moisture within the rifle scope’s tube is filling the tube with a gas like nitrogen. Since this area is currently taken up by the gas, the glass is less affected by climate shifts and pressure differences from the outside environment which might potentially enable water vapor to leak in around the seals to fill the void which would otherwise be there.
